We are currently recruiting an enthusiastic and dedicated Level 2 or Level 3 qualified EYFS Teaching Assistant to join a welcoming primary school in Tower Hamlets on either a full-time or part-time basis.

The Role

In this role, you will support the class teacher within the Early Years Foundation Stage, helping to create a safe, nurturing, and engaging learning environment for young children. You will work closely with pupils throughout the school day, supporting their learning, development, and social interaction through play-based and structured activities.

You may provide 1:1 support or work with small groups of children, helping to develop early literacy, numeracy, communication, and social skills. Adaptability, patience, and a positive attitude are essential, as you will be supporting children with varying needs and abilities while ensuring high standards of care and safeguarding are maintained at all times.
